机顶盒升级情况统计方法技术

技术编号:8657878 阅读:176 留言:0更新日期:2013-05-02 01:53
本发明专利技术公开了一种机顶盒升级情况统计方法。所述方法为:当机顶盒出厂第一次开机时,读出自身软件版本号,将自身软件版本号备份到非易失性存储器中;机顶盒每次开机或升级完成后,均读出自身软件版本号,并与备份的原软件版本号作比较,如果软件版本号不一致说明软件有更新,则机顶盒通过网络把升级信息反馈给广电前端系统;广电前端系统对收到的升级信息进行解析、存储并显示在服务器中,并向机顶盒回传处理消息;机顶盒收到后,将新升级的软件版本号写入非易失性存储器中。相对于现有技术,采用本发明专利技术所述方法,可使广电前端系统对各用户升级情况轻松进行统计,准确率高,避免长时间发送升级文件,占用系统资源,节约人力物力。

【技术实现步骤摘要】

本专利技术涉及有线数字电视领域,具体涉及一种对于有线数字电视机顶盒升级情况的统计方法。
技术介绍
在数字电话普及的今天,机顶盒在线升级已不是新鲜事,几乎所有的机顶盒都带此功能,但是一直有个问题困扰着机顶盒厂家和各地广播电视台:即当广电有新需求需要升级机顶盒时,总是有诸多顾虑,其中之一就是用户家里的机顶盒到底有没有升级完成,由于用户数量之多,无法用人工进行统计,而广电为了保证用户都能升级,通常是分批次和长时间播发升级文件来降低风险,如播发半年等,如此浪费了设备资源和人力,风险也无法确实得到保证。如果停播升级文件出现升级故障,则更会浪费大量维修维护成本,还将导致用户不能正常观看电视。
技术实现思路
为了克服现有技术存在的问题,本专利技术提供一种对于有线数字电视前端节目源的监控方法。本专利技术采取的技术方案予如下: 一种, 当机顶盒出厂第一次开机时,读出自身软件版本号,将自身软件版本号备份到非易失性存储器中; 机顶盒每次开机或升级完成后,均读出自身软件版本号,并与备份的原软件版本号作比较,如果软件版本号不一致说明软件有更新,则机顶盒通过网络把升级信息反馈给广电iu端系统; 广电前端系统对收到的升级信息进行解析、存储并显示在服务器中,以便工作人员查阅; 广电前端系统向发送升级信息的机顶盒回传处理消息; 机顶盒收到后,将新升级的软件版本号写入非易失性存储器中,并不再发送升级信息。优选的,所述升级信息包括机顶盒唯一序列号、升级后的软件版本号、升级时间、当前升级次数。具体的,新升级的软件版本号以覆盖原软件版本号的方式写入非易失性存储器中,并记录写入次数。或者新升级的软件版本号不覆盖原软件版本号写入非易失性存储器中,并记录写入次数。本专利技术相对于现有技术具有如下有益效果:采用本专利技术所述方法,可使广电前端系统对各用户升级情况轻松进行统计,准确率高,避免长时间发送升级文件,占用系统资源,节约人力物力。具体实施例方式为了便于本领域技术人员的理解,下面将对本专利技术作进一步的详细描述。本专利技术公开了一种,该方法是利用机顶盒软件升级后软件版本号都会更新变化这一特点,实现机顶盒与广电前端系统的相互沟通,进而实现升级情况统计。本专利技术所述方法具体如下: 首先,机顶盒出厂第一次开机时,读出自身软件版本号,将自身软件版本号备份到非易失性存储器中。之后,在机顶盒每次开机或升级完成后,均读出自身软件版本号,并与备份的原软件版本号作比较,如果软件版本号不一致说明软件有更新,则机顶盒通过网络把升级后的软件版本号、升级时间、当前升级次数等升级信息连同该机顶盒自身唯一的序列号一起打包以约定的数据格式反馈给广电前端系统。广电前端系统对接收到的升级信息进行解析处理,解析出该机顶盒的序列号及对应的软件版本号、升级时间、当前升级次数等信息显示在服务器中,以便工作人员查阅,同时将解析出的信息存储备查。广电前端系统对接收到的升级信息处理完后,向发送升级信息的机顶盒回传处理消息,机顶盒收到后,将新升级的软件版本号写入非易失性存储器中,待下次比较并不再重复发送升级信息。存储时,新升级的软件版本号可以覆盖原软件版本号的方式写入非易失性存储器中,并记录写入次数。也可以不覆盖原软件版本号,而在原版本号存储地址后写入新版本好,并记录写入次数,这样便于统计升级次数以及对升级前的运行软件版本进行核查。本专利技术中未具体介绍的部分均为现有技术,在此不赘述.以上所述实施例仅表达了本专利技术的实施方式,其描述较为具体和详细,但并不能因此而理解为对本专利技术专利范围的限制,但凡采用等同替换或等效变换的形式所获得的技术方案,均应落在本专利技术的保护范围之内。本文档来自技高网...

【技术保护点】
机顶盒升级情况统计方法,当机顶盒出厂第一次开机时,读出自身软件版本号,将自身软件版本号备份到非易失性存储器中;机顶盒每次开机或升级完成后,均读出自身软件版本号,并与备份的原软件版本号作比较,如果软件版本号不一致说明软件有更新,则机顶盒通过网络把升级信息反馈给广电前端系统;广电前端系统对收到的升级信息进行解析、存储并显示在服务器中,以便工作人员查阅;广电前端系统向发送升级信息的机顶盒回传处理消息;机顶盒收到后,将新升级的软件版本号写入非易失性存储器中,并不再发送升级信息。

【技术特征摘要】
1.机顶盒升级情况统计方法, 当机顶盒出厂第一次开机时,读出自身软件版本号,将自身软件版本号备份到非易失性存储器中; 机顶盒每次开机或升级完成后,均读出自身软件版本号,并与备份的原软件版本号作比较,如果软件版本号不一致说明软件有更新,则机顶盒通过网络把升级信息反馈给广电iu端系统; 广电前端系统对收到的升级信息进行解析、存储并显示在服务器中,以便工作人员查阅; 广电前端系统向发送升级信息的机顶盒回传处理消息; 机顶盒收到后,将新升级的软件版本...

【专利技术属性】
技术研发人员:陈文超唐浩
申请(专利权)人:广东九联科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1